arm-sdk

os build toolkit for various embedded devices
git clone https://git.parazyd.org/arm-sdk
Log | Files | Refs | Submodules | README | LICENSE

commit 36a8f8a9c413c6fe2770a247ce4cef1ba40f478a
parent 8ed4f5a52f35c5b288074b7ef00f0776cd8515a3
Author: parazyd <parazyd@dyne.org>
Date:   Fri, 30 Sep 2016 15:18:38 +0200

add debugging options

Diffstat:
Mboards/raspberry-pi.sh | 14+++++++-------
Msdk | 6++++++
2 files changed, 13 insertions(+), 7 deletions(-)

diff --git a/boards/raspberry-pi.sh b/boards/raspberry-pi.sh @@ -131,17 +131,17 @@ build_kernel_armhf() { $R/tmp/kernels/$device_name/${device_name}-firmware fi - sudo cp -rfv $R/tmp/kernels/$device_name/${device_name}-firmware/boot/* $strapdir/boot/ + sudo cp $CPVERBOSE -rf $R/tmp/kernels/$device_name/${device_name}-firmware/boot/* $strapdir/boot/ - pushd ${device_name}-linux + pushd $R/tmp/kernels/$device_name/${device_name}-linux sudo perl scripts/mkknlimg --dtok arch/arm/boot/zImage $strapdir/boot/kernel7.img - sudo cp -v arch/arm/boot/dts/bcm*.dtb $strapdir/boot/ - sudo cp -v arch/arm/boot/dts/overlays/*overlay*.dtb $strapdir/boot/overlays/ + sudo cp $CPVERBOSE arch/arm/boot/dts/bcm*.dtb $strapdir/boot/ + sudo cp $CPVERBOSE arch/arm/boot/dts/overlays/*overlay*.dtb $strapdir/boot/overlays/ popd sudo rm -rf $strapdir/lib/firmware get-kernel-firmware - sudo cp -ra $R/tmp/linux-firmware $strapdir/lib/firmware + sudo cp $CPVERBOSE -ra $R/tmp/linux-firmware $strapdir/lib/firmware pushd $R/tmp/kernels/$device_name/${device_name}-linux sudo -E make INSTALL_MOD_PATH=$strapdir firmware_install @@ -169,8 +169,8 @@ EOF notice "installing raspberry pi 3 firmware for bt/wifi" sudo mkdir -p $strapdir/lib/firmware/brcm - sudo cp -v $R/extra/rpi3/brcmfmac43430-sdio.txt $strapdir/lib/firmware/brcm/ - sudo cp -v $R/extra/rpi3/brcmfmac43430-sdio.bin $strapdir/lib/firmware/brcm/ + sudo cp $CPVERBOSE $R/extra/rpi3/brcmfmac43430-sdio.txt $strapdir/lib/firmware/brcm/ + sudo cp $CPVERBOSE $R/extra/rpi3/brcmfmac43430-sdio.bin $strapdir/lib/firmware/brcm/ postbuild || zerr } diff --git a/sdk b/sdk @@ -26,6 +26,12 @@ R=${ARM_SDK:-$PWD} ## load zsh extension "Zuper" DEBUG=1 + +[[ $DEBUG = 1 ]] && { + ## add -v to cp calls + CPVERBOSE="-v" +} + source lib/zuper/zuper ## global vars